I have 2 uva-uvb light systems, 2 zoo-med 10.0 24" for sunlight during the day. Then at night 1 blacklight. For heat I have 2 heat emitters. Large tortoise box 4'6'. Is there any problems.
For the tube lights, keep in mind after about 6 months, they start loosing their effectiveness. After a year, for that model, they need to be replaced according to the manufacturer. You also need to know the recommended distance between light and tort - too far away, and your tort may not be getting the benefits of the UVB.
The heat emitters - are the Ceramic Heat Emitters (CHEs)? Are the set up near the UVB to encourage basking under the UVB?
